1. Choose the meaning of the word 'contravene' in the following sentence: 'Did the interns contravene the doctor’s orders?'
- A. Comply with
- B. Misjudge
- C. Comprehend
- D. Disregard
Correct answer: D
Rationale: The word 'contravene' in this sentence means to go against or disobey. Therefore, the correct meaning is closest to 'disregard.' The interns did not follow or comply with the doctor's orders, indicating that they contravened them. 'Comply with' (Choice A) is the opposite of 'contravene,' 'misjudge' (Choice B) and 'comprehend' (Choice C) do not accurately reflect the meaning of 'contravene' in this context.
2. What is the meaning of perused?
- A. Passed judgment on
- B. Engaged in
- C. Read thoroughly
- D. Took notes about
Correct answer: C
Rationale: The correct answer is C: 'Read thoroughly.' The word 'perused' means to read or examine carefully or in detail. It does not imply passing judgment, engaging in, or taking notes. Choices A, B, and D are incorrect because 'perused' specifically refers to reading thoroughly, not making judgments, participating in, or taking notes.
3. What is the best description for the word efficacy in the following sentence? The quality, safety, and efficacy of counterfeit medicines are not known.
- A. Effectiveness
- B. Significance
- C. Corollary
- D. Conclusion
Correct answer: A
Rationale: In the context of the sentence provided, efficacy refers to the ability of counterfeit medicines to produce the intended or desired effect. Efficacy is closely related to effectiveness, which is the correct description in this context. 'Significance' (Choice B), 'Corollary' (Choice C), and 'Conclusion' (Choice D) do not accurately capture the meaning of efficacy in this context.
